B1W by Blueskysea https://www.amazon.com/dp/B0773FXVKL/?coliid=I19C9AXF5DOL2H&colid=QN6ZDL5RPQ22&psc=1&ref_=lv_ov_lig_dp_it I'm going to repost this camera because mine still working 100% after 3.5 years. I've bought 5 and gave them out as gifts to friends and family. All working as intended. Pros: - Very good video in daylight, serviceable at night. License plates can get washed out in direct headlights, but it's a universal dashcam problem. pretty sure there is a polarizing cap available - Capacitors, not batteries - Very small power draw, I've recorded 2 days straight while the car was parked and was still plenty of juice to start and drive. Leaving it on overnight should not be an issue - Tiny footprint, it's slightly bigger than my thumb. - Completely discreet, it blends with a mirror plastic and is smaller than mirror profile. You have to look hard to see it. And the tiny LED light is facing the cabin. Also, out of YOUR field of vision completely. Like it's not even there, and you can hide the wire under the headliner and pillar plastic - Cheap! $50-60 depending on current sale - Lens part is adjustable on Y axis - Removable from its base, ships with 2 bases. Can be easily transferred between 2 vehicles. - Wifi connection standard, GPS and collision sensor optional - Despite 16GB recommendation, it works with 256 class 10 cards no problem. Cons: - Microphone sucks. Very muted, so your conversation with a police officer is going to be very one sided on the recording - Ships with a short miniUSB cord and looong miniUSB/cigarette lighter. Should be the other way around - WiFi is a bit clunky and you have to turn off cellular connection on your phone in order to use it. Instructions do not mention this, and there are some negative reviews because of it - Firmware update is a convoluted process, luckily you don't need to do that - Collision and GPS are add ons and pain to setup, could have been just integrated into a different, more expensive model In conclusion, I haven't seen a better dashcam in the price range. If you want something that just works, this is it

Nitrox posted:B1W by Blueskysea I have the same cam but connecting to it with my iPhone doesn’t require me to turn off the cellar connection. I just connect to it’s WiFi network and open the app. I agree on all the points you mentioned though. One con to me is that it’s slow transferring videos over WiFi IMO. SD card is super easy to remove though so I just go that route.

I've been using Shotcut for a few years now, it's pretty good for basic chopping and cropping for dashcam videos and the like. Free, open source, all that good stuff, and a decent amount of tutorials on Youtube to get you started.

if they're h.264 encoded mp4s, you can use something like gpac/mp4box to extract exactly the video you want it's a command line tool, but i think someone slapped together a basic gui for it

Flint Ironstag posted:I have been wondering about that for quite some time. There are legitimately people who will take no action to avoid an accident because they have the ROW. I’ve dealt with a number of them over the years in the insurance world. They’re always surprised when they get hit with some degree of fault after just telling you they saw the guy merging and didn’t try to avoid it in any way, or even accelerated to close the gap.
